Subject: StormPing fan-out cut-over complete

Cut-over to the new StormPing alert fan-out finished at 03:40. Old Gustline dispatcher drained and stopped. Alert latency p95 down to 1.2s across the Verdane region feeds. One retry storm during DNS flip; resolved in four minutes. No dropped county alerts. Rollback window closes Friday. The active production configuration as deployed is listed below.

settings of tahof-yahap:
quenwyn:
  log_level: error
  metrics_host: metrics.quenwyn.lumiclabs.internal
  pool_size: 8

### Slow autocomplete index in CI

If the Lanternwick autocomplete build exceeds ten minutes, the culprit is usually the prefix-expansion step rerunning on unchanged dictionaries. Check that the cache volume mounted correctly before blaming the indexer itself. Warm caches bring this down to roughly ninety seconds. When filing a report, include the token printed at the end of the index stage.

pipeline stamp: htk9_ce63042d9

Step 4: Migrate the rebalancing scheduler for PedalFlow. Before merging, confirm that the dock-capacity thresholds from the legacy Kerrivale deployment were ported verbatim; the new solver reads them at startup and silently falls back to defaults if any key is missing. Pay particular attention to the van-routing weights, since an off-by-one in the zone index caused ghost trips in staging last quarter. Once you have verified the schema version, apply the configuration values shown below.

deployment values, yadug-bawif:
[framir]
team = pelox
access_code = ac_a38ab2
owner = tamion.julael
host = framir.tolvaqlabs.test
port = 11211
peer = tammir.zemvargrid.local
salt = 2215ef03
pin = 1541